Wednesday, March 24th - Day 37

Today was a good day for Brian - he had his lowest blood pressure yet!

He was also very 'alert' today - lots of reactive eye opening to multiple kinds of stimulus (sound / voices, touch, etc.) It's important to note that he is opening his eyes as a response, but it's great sign of his energy and his ability to react to his surroundings.

In the last 2 weeks, I have seen this, but usually anywhere from 1-4x per day. Today he opened up about 6x within the first hour I arrived! And continued to do so, on and off, for several hours while Erin, his sister, tried some new OT stimulation. She brought different textured objects that she placed in his hands or rubbed on his arms/shoulders to see if he would react (a few times he did) and she put an ice pack in his hand, which he pushed away!

When I left this evening, they downsized his trach hole size, which was the next step in his independent breathing process.

Overall, it seems like Brian has done well with every 'challenge,' gets good rest, and then shows up a little stronger, so I am encouraged by his progress today! Praying for another restful night & more updates to come tomorrow.
